Transaction 0030843fea8571e301601ac52fa2f1a40407f98a9b2d5c15dca0c74e767d4e2f

1 Input
1 Outputs
  • 0030843fea8571e301601ac52fa2f1a40407f98a9b2d5c15dca0c74e767d4e2f:0
  • value  82784006
    address  3AskrcXoYcvhcMmHCvEiGnBvPKvbEwkeYY